About MercadoLibre, Inc. - Common Stock (MELI)

Mercadolibre Inc is a leading e-commerce and fintech company based in Latin America, specializing in providing a comprehensive online marketplace for buying and selling a wide variety of products. The platform enables individuals and businesses to engage in transactions efficiently, offering features such as auctions, fixed-price listings, and a robust payment processing system through its integrated service, Mercado Pago. Additionally, the company has expanded its reach into logistics, ensuring smooth delivery services to enhance the shopping experience. With a focus on innovation and technology, Mercadolibre continuously strives to empower merchants and consumers across Latin America, driving growth in the digital economy. Read More
